Catalytic Converter Handling Precautions

            0

Especially dangerous for the converter is an unburned combustible mixture, which can ignite in a highly heated catalyst and thereby increase its temperature to a dangerous level. In addition, fuel accumulates in the converter, and after starting the engine, due to detonation combustion, the ceramic body can be damaged. Therefore, when carrying out repair and other work, you should pay attention to the following:

- when the battery is discharged, the engine is started using an auxiliary wire from an external battery. If the starter is defective, the vehicle should only be moved, shifted or towed for short distances. A running engine starts after a few meters of movement. If this does not happen, find out the reason, but do not tow the car for a long distance;

- the presence of interruptions in sparking or incorrect injection indicate a malfunction in the ignition system. The system should be checked immediately;

- if the bearing is damaged, do not move with «dead» cylinder, but in the absence of a converter, this can be done without problems;

- in hot summer, after several weeks of dry weather, do not park the vehicle over dry leaves, hay, etc. - they can ignite;

- in the presence of anti-corrosion protection of the bottom, the protection of the converter also becomes better;

- check, usually with the vehicle jacked up, that the thermal protection made of metal sheets is not damaged or missing.
